Why Minimalist Design Works in Online Casinos

Simple design choices create powerful results for online casino platforms. Players respond remarkably well to clean, thoughtful interfaces. Studies reveal that a minimalistic approach speeds up load times by 30%. This is crucial since 45% of users leave websites that load too slowly.

Clean casino interfaces help players stay focused on what matters most – their gaming experience. This approach removes distracting elements that might pull players away from their gaming journey. The magic lies in highlighting essential elements like:

  • Game selection menus
  • Account management tools
  • Payment options
  • Support services

Faster Decision Making and Reduced Cognitive Load

Simple layouts make a world of difference in player choices. Most players find their way to the gambling lobby, select a game, and place wagers within 20 seconds on well-designed platforms. Clear pathways guide users exactly where they need to go, reducing rushed or impulsive decisions.

The human brain works best with simple, clear information. Too much visual noise leads to mental fatigue and task abandonment. Smart casino design strips away unnecessary colors, images, and decorative elements. Players can focus on enjoying their favorite games instead of figuring out complex menus.

Mobile gaming especially benefits from this approach – 75% of users prefer simple, clean designs. The thoughtful use of a simple-to-use space and carefully chosen colors creates a gaming environment where players make confident decisions without feeling overwhelmed.

Key Elements of Minimalist Casino Design

The magic of successful casino design lies in three core elements working together to create a smooth, engaging player experience.

Clean Navigation Structure

Smart navigation puts key features right at the top of the page where players expect them. Players jump effortlessly between games, promotions, and account settings without getting lost in complex menus. The main control panel packs multiple features into a clean, familiar layout that feels natural to use.

Strategic Use of White Space

Breathing room matters in casino design. White space around text and key elements boosts readability by 20%. This thoughtful approach to spacing does more than look good, it guides players’ eyes exactly where they need to go. Game selections and important buttons naturally draw attention through clever use of empty space.

Simple color schemes

The right colors set the perfect mood while keeping things clean and simple. Winning casino designs stick to these proven color combinations:

  • Dark backgrounds with smart lighting help players focus
  • Trustworthy blue tones that make players feel secure
  • Modern gray and green pairs that keep things fresh
  • Clean base colors with just two or three eye-catching accents

Finding the sweet spot between these elements takes skill. Some designers prefer dark-tinted surfaces with minimal decorative touches, creating spaces that work beautifully while looking stunning. Players love this approach, making them more engaged while playing casino games.
